Exciting Toormore Takes Vintage Stakes
31/07/13

1 Toormore 5/4F
2 Outstrip 5/1
3 Parbold 11/4
7 ran Distances: nk, 1½l, 2¾l
TIME 1m 27.57s (slow by 3.27s)

Toormore, described by Richard Hughes as 'one of the nicest two-year-olds in the yard', continued the tremendous Goodwood record of the rider and trainer Richard Hannon. In the Veuve Cliquot Vintage Stakes, the son of Arakan gave Hughes his third winner of Glorious week, and Hannon his fourth.

Hughes swooped typically late to take the seven-furlong Group Two contest by a neck from fellow previous maiden winner Outstrip, with Coventry Stakes runner-up Parbold a length and a half third.

"He's a big baby mentally and physically still," said Hughes, "so he did well there, the second horse kept on well and mine had three lengths to make up. He'll get a mile easily in time and though the Guineas is being talked about already that's a long way away. He is one of our nicest two-year-olds but he'll have to fill out and develop a bit more before he's the real deal."

Toormore is clearly held in some regard. "We left him out of Royal Ascot because he was a bit weak," said Hannon's assistant and son Richard, "and he still is. It looks as if he wants a mile now, and the Royal Lodge and the Dewhurst Stakes are races that will be on his agenda later in the season."

Asked if Toormore is the next Toronado, Hannon said: "That would be nice, wouldn't it?"

Hannon pointed out that the colt is the third cheaply-bought (£36,000 as a yearling) son of Arakan, based at Ballyhane Stud in Co Carlow, to win a Group race for the stable, the others being Dick Turpin and Trumpet Major.

MORE CHAMPAGNE FOR OUTSTRIP?

Outstrip just failed to outstrip all when he went down by a neck to Toormore in the Group Two Veuve Clicquot Vintage Stakes, though connections were far from disappointed with the the home bred's display.

This was only Outstrip's second run, his first being a impressive maiden win at Newmarket in June, and Simon Crisford, racing Manager for Godolphin, the Exceed And Excel colt's owners, commented: "He's run a super race and looked like winning every-where but the line. He's a nice colt. Seven furlongs next time - we will keep him to that trip.

"He showed a really good turn of foot when Mickael (Barzalona, jockey) asked him to go, the winner just came past us at the line but our colt is good. He will run in races like the Group Two Champagne Stakes at Doncaster - those are his long term targets."

Mickael Barzalona, jockey of Outstrip, added: "He ran very well."
